自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(31)
  • 收藏
  • 关注

原创 第八次作业

8import java.util.ArrayList;import java.util.Collections;import java.util.Comparator;class Fs{ private double x; private double y; public Fs(double x, double y) {this.x = x; this.y = y;} public void show() { if (y == 0)

2020-12-20 20:21:23 92

原创 第七次作业

**1:**Java中流从流动方向看分为输出流和输入流。以读取的类型来看分为字符流和字节流,这两者之间可以相互转换。2:Inputstream的子类(1)FileInputstream在文件读取时使用(2)PipedInputsream在进行管道接收时使用(3)ObjectInputstream在对象串行化时使用Outputstream的子类(1)FileOutputstream在文件写时使用(2)PipedOutputsream在进行管道输出时使用(3)ObjecOutputtstream

2020-12-20 20:05:49 60

原创 第六次作业

1一共分为7层。物理层实现比特形式的信息传输,数据链路层是网络邻节点设备间二进制信息传输的通道,网络层是解决跨越多个链路以及不同网络设备间的通信问题,传输层解决不同网络设备间的通信连接,通信管理。应用层表示层会话层就是为客户提供服务的通信协议。2 1:Tcp协议数据传输之前要进行三次握手连接法而udp不需要建立连接而是直接发送2:TCP协议可以传输大量数据因为它能够保证对方接收到所有传输信息而UDP协议因为其不建立连接导致传输数据时会导致缺损所以传输的数据有限制且不可靠但是它操作简单而且传输效率高。

2020-11-15 09:30:20 127

原创 第五次作业

1volatile关键字有什么作用?用volatile修饰的变量,线程在每次使用变量的时候,都会读取变量修改后的最的值

2020-11-08 10:03:52 101

原创 第四次作业

1.相同点就是它们的实现基于字符数组,封装了对字符串处理的各种操作,同时都可以自动检测数组越界等运行时的异常。不同点就在于String类一旦被赋值就不能更改其指向对象若更改则会指向一个新的字符对象。而StringBuffer和StringBuilder进行更改时是在原来的地址中对字符串进行更改而不是分配一个新的空间。StringBuffer与StringBuilder的区别在于前者非线程更加安全后者则是线程更加安全2.for循环中用+进行运算是如果是字符串的话每次进行运算时=是都要新建对象浪费时间的同

2020-11-01 15:20:43 58

原创 银行管理系统c++改写java总结

1.java中每个私有属性前都得加关键字否则会成为默认属性2.java中是没有运算符重载这种操作的。比如说c++中可以通过运算符重载使得两个类进行相减或者相加,这时我们有两个办法解决。1就是将进行操作的域变量变为public这样通过对象引用就可以实现相关操作但缺点是相关域变量不在被封装。2通过设计函数来实现运算符重载。3.static属性的方法或者函数只能够使用static域变量否则会出现报错。4.c++中的虚类或者虚函数就是java中的抽象类或者函数。但是java中抽象类的函数只有声明没有具体实现方

2020-11-01 15:00:48 160

原创 异常处理的两种方式以及区别

异常处理的方式有两种。一种是声明抛出处理,另外一种是捕获处理。声明抛出处理有分为隐式抛出和显示抛出。特点是程序方法可以对异常不进行处理,让调用该方法的地方处理。而嵌套处理时通过try-catch-finally来解决当出现异常时程序会自己进行处理。...

2020-10-25 08:52:21 1079

原创 JAVA中Error与Exception的区别

Error发生时程序会直接停止,而Exception发生时,程序会捕获和进行处理程序不会停止

2020-10-25 08:47:18 84

原创 instanceof的使用场景

instanceof用于判断前面的对象是否是后面的类,或者其子类、实现类的实例。就是判断一个对象的声明是否为该对象的实例引用。如A a=new A()那么使用instanceof时为true或者A a=new B()然后B是A的子类那么结果为false反过来为true...

2020-10-18 11:05:41 433

原创 java运行时多态是什么含义

运行时多态就是覆盖,就是子类方法覆盖父类方法。使用父类引用指向子类对象,再调用某一父类中的方法时,不同子类会表现出不同结果。

2020-10-18 10:58:54 166

原创 组合与继承的区别以及应用场景

组合只是将两个类结合起来其中一个类是另外一个类的域变量两个类之间无上下级关系。而继承则是如果子类建立那么父类一定要先建立的这种关系。所以当你只需要使用另外一个类的方法时使用组合,但是如果你需要使用另外一个类的作用时但你不想被其他的类访问用继承反之组合。...

2020-10-18 10:49:35 242

原创 如何实现两个对象之间发消息

可以通过引用的方式。当一个类在域变量中声明另外一个对象时,两个对象之间就可以互发消息。

2020-10-18 10:44:24 335

原创 覆盖是什么,作用?

覆盖就是父类的方法子类可以访问时,子类通过一个完全一样的函数名和参数覆盖了父类但是函数作用可以不同。类可以通过super使用被覆盖的父类函数。

2020-10-18 10:40:44 1057

原创 重载是什么,作用

重载就是相同函数名但是参数不同的函数。作用就是当子类想用相同的函数的作用但是输出或者参数输入有差别时使用。

2020-10-18 10:37:52 367

原创 什么是组合,作用是什么?

A类的对象是B类的成员变量。相当于 A类是B类对象的一个属性。作用:当一个类需要访问另外一个类的域变量或者方法而不是需要继承时可以通过组合来实现。

2020-10-18 10:36:05 373

原创 java数组元素为基本数据类型和引用类型时区别

Java数组元素为基本数据类型时,数组中的所有元素都是基本数据类型,Java数组元素为引用类型时,数组中的所有元素都是对象。

2020-10-11 14:46:33 432

原创 float[10] arr是否错误

错误,声明时不可在方括号内指定数组大小。

2020-10-11 14:44:53 124

原创 Java中final的作用

当用final修饰一个类时,表明这个类不能被继承修饰方法时把方法锁定,以防任何继承类修改它的含义final成员变量表示常量,只能被赋值一次,赋值后值不再改变

2020-10-11 14:40:03 56

原创 static与非static的区别。

static修饰的类属性或者对象被保存在类的内存区的公共存储单元中,可以被类,多个对象引用访问。当类的属性或方法需要被类的1对象多次引用时就用static修饰

2020-10-11 14:38:23 66

原创 对象的初始化顺序

如果类中有静态属性那么首先对静态属性进行一次初始化且只进行一次,然后就是给类的其它属性分配内存空间。

2020-10-11 14:35:25 44

原创 对象作为参数传递的特点

作为对象引用传递可以改变

2020-10-11 14:33:59 115

原创 对象与对象引用的区别

对象一定分配了内存空间但是对象引用不一定。对象引用类似与对象的一张名片。

2020-10-11 14:32:04 108

原创 2020-09-27

逻辑运算符&&只要一个条件为false另外一个不会计算。但是&两个条件表达式都会进行运算无论是否为true。位运算符&是进行两个数二进制与的运算如3&5=0000 0001而逻辑运算符&是进行两个表达式的判断如3+5>8 & 3+4<7=0。...

2020-09-27 13:26:06 46

原创 2020-09-27

Integer是int的包装类int是基本的数据类型Integer必须实例化才能用int变量不需要实例化。转换Integer vari=new Integer(5);

2020-09-27 13:21:12 38

原创 2020-09-23

java跳出多循环可以用break语句和continue语句。跳出内循环只需在需要结束的代码后面加上break或者continue就可以。跳出外循环就需要通过带标号的语句跳出如break lab或者continue lab

2020-09-23 19:05:02 43

原创 2020-09-23

包装类的目的1基本数据类型不是类,有的时候不能直接使用2包装类的一些静态方法可以实现不同的数据类型转换

2020-09-23 19:02:02 40

原创 2020-09-23

Java的数据类型包括char,byte,short,long,int,float,double,boolean等

2020-09-23 18:56:38 52

原创 2020-09-23

JDK是java程序的编译环境,JRE是java程序的运作环境。而JVM是平台软件负责将字节码编译成机器码。

2020-09-23 18:54:42 48

原创 2020-09-23

Java不管在哪个操作系统只要安装了虚拟机就能运行Java代码。因为java要经过编译和解释最后都变成了二进制。任何操作系统都能识别二进制所以java可以跨平台实现。

2020-09-23 18:52:18 60

原创 2020-09-23

Java语言的特点的话就是1简单2面向对象3稳定性和安全性4多线程并且动态5高性能和分布式

2020-09-23 18:48:47 50

原创 2020-09-23

学习编程语言的方法经验和教训方法的话就是上课认真听老师讲的语法知识,课上没怎么听懂的话课后一定要话时间以自己的思维逻辑去理解这样那个语法算法你才算明白了。教训的话就是经常出现小问题,忘写分号或者ifelse没有用中括号的习惯搞的后面看代码的时候有点头晕。...

2020-09-23 18:46:43 48

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除